About Yoxall

Yoxall is a village located in Staffordshire, England, within the postcode area DE13. It is situated near the River Swarbourn, which flows through the village, providing a natural feature for residents and visitors alike. The village has a number of local amenities, including shops, a primary school, and a community centre, making it a convenient place for everyday needs.

The surrounding countryside offers opportunities for walking and enjoying the outdoors. Yoxall is well-connected by road, with easy access to nearby towns such as Lichfield and Burton-upon-Trent. The village has a mix of traditional and modern housing, contributing to its character. Overall, Yoxall presents a pleasant environment for those looking to experience village life in Staffordshire.

Household Income in Yoxall ONS 2023

The average total household income in Yoxall is approximately £57,010 a year before tax, 3% above the national average of £55,302. After tax and benefits, the average disposable (net) household income is around £40,495. These are modelled estimates from the Office for National Statistics for the financial year ending 2023.

Businesses in Yoxall ONS 2025

There are approximately 1,679 active businesses based in Yoxall, around 38 for every 1,000 residents. The local economy is dominated by small firms: about 91% are micro-businesses employing fewer than 10 people, while 31 are larger employers with 50 or more staff. Figures are from the Office for National Statistics UK Business Counts.

Home Ownership in Yoxall

Of the 18,692 households in and around Yoxall, 78% are owned, 9% are socially rented and 13% are privately rented. Home ownership here is higher than the England and Wales average of 63%.

Owned 78% Social rented 9% Private rented 13%

Tenure from the 2021 Census (ONS), for the postcode districts covering Yoxall.
